Ant colony longevity

February 22nd - via: kickstarter.com
Though there are many variables in play here, Harvester Ants typically last about 2-3 months before all the workers expire. Once the first colony expires, a second and possibly even third colony may be used with the same set of gel after the expired... (Read More)
